在计算机操作系统的历史长河中,批处理系统扮演了重要角色。它不仅是计算机发展的早期产物,更是现代操作系统设计理念的基石。本文将带您深入了解批处理系统的特点、应用场景以及它独特的魅力。

批处理系统的起源与发展

批处理系统(Batch Processing System)起源于20世纪50年代的计算机时代。在那个时期,计算机资源非常有限,为了提高计算机的利用率,研究人员开始探索如何批量处理任务,减少人工干预。随着时间的推移,批处理系统逐渐发展成熟,成为了早期操作系统的主要形式。

批处理系统的特点

1. 批量处理任务

批处理系统将多个任务组织成一批,然后由计算机依次执行。这种方式大大减少了用户等待时间,提高了计算机资源利用率。

2. 自动执行

批处理系统无需人工干预,任务自动执行。用户只需将任务提交给系统,系统会自动按照预定的顺序执行。

3. 高效的资源利用

批处理系统能够有效地利用计算机资源,如CPU、内存和磁盘等。通过批量处理任务,减少了设备闲置时间,提高了系统整体性能。

4. 简化操作

批处理系统简化了用户操作,用户只需编写脚本或程序,将任务提交给系统即可。系统会自动完成后续操作,降低了用户的使用门槛。

批处理系统的应用场景

1. 企业级应用

在大型企业中,批处理系统常用于处理大量数据,如财务报表、工资核算等。通过批处理,企业可以高效地完成数据处理工作。

2. 网络应用

在网络环境中,批处理系统可以用于批量更新软件、部署应用程序等。这种方式可以降低网络拥堵,提高系统稳定性。

3. 服务器管理

服务器管理员可以利用批处理系统批量执行任务,如定期备份数据、检查系统运行状态等。这有助于提高服务器管理效率。

4. 研究领域

在科研领域,批处理系统可以用于处理大量实验数据,如模拟实验、数据分析等。通过批量处理,研究人员可以更高效地完成研究工作。

批处理系统的魅力

1. 简化操作

批处理系统将复杂任务简化为简单的脚本或程序,降低了用户的使用门槛。

2. 提高效率

批量处理任务可以节省用户时间,提高工作效率。

3. 便于管理

批处理系统便于任务管理,用户可以轻松地查看任务执行状态和结果。

4. 历史传承

批处理系统是计算机发展史上的重要里程碑,它的许多设计理念至今仍被现代操作系统所继承。

总结

批处理系统作为一种古老的操作系统形式,在当今社会依然具有独特的魅力和应用场景。了解批处理系统的特点和应用,有助于我们更好地认识计算机发展史,并为现代操作系统设计提供借鉴。